George Monoux was Walthamstow’s first benefactor and probably it’s most wealthy and famous. Monoux began his rise to fame and fortune as a merchant adventurer in Bristol during the 1480’s exporting cloth to Bordeaux, Spain and Portugal, and importing wine, oil, salt and sugar. WebThe almshouses were built soon after; a plaque above the door gives a date of 1716, but that refers to the date of the endowment, not the completion of the almhouses. Initially they were known as the New Almshouse, to distinguish them from the Old Almshouse, a few yards away on Church Street, now known as the Montague Almshouses. WebThe almshouses are arranged in three blocks around a central lawn. The original foundation, Stone’s Building, consists of four one-bedroom flats and one double flat for a couple. This block won two awards when it was renovated and modernised in 2009. The two other blocks were built in the 1960s. One was extended and refurbished in 2024. WebThe Chingford Almshouses were built at the Green in Chingford in 1859, in 1957 the five almshouses were sold and new almshouses were built at Templeton Avenue, Chingford in 1959.
